Max Verstappen brushed off a difficult weekend in Singapore last time out with a stellar performance to seal pole position for the Japanese Grand Prix.
The Red Bull racer has topped every session so far this weekend and took top spot in qualifying with a scintillating 1m 28.877s lap – 0.581s faster than second-placed Oscar Piastri.
With that stunning return to form for the championship leader, he will be the hot favourite for another victory in the Grand Prix itself, and could help Red Bull clinch another constructors’ title in the process tomorrow.
